导航
当前位置:首页>>app
在线生成app,封装app

apple开发者不需要编程

2023-11-10 围观 : 4次

这个说法并不准确。虽然苹果公司提供了易于使用的开发工具来帮助开发者创建应用程序,但这并不意味着开发者不需要编程。

首先,苹果公司提供的开发工具是建立在编程语言之上的。Swift是苹果推出的一种流行的编程语言,被用于创建iOS、macOS和watchOS应用程序。Objective-C是另一种用于开发iOS和macOS应用程序的语言。与其他编程语言相比,这些语言具有易学、简洁和强大的特点,但仍需要编程知识才能使用。

其次,开发者需要理解应用程序的生命周期、UI设计和程序逻辑等方面的概念。在无法理解这些概念的情况下,即使是最简单的应用程序也无法创建。

第三,像Xcode这样的开发工具,虽然是易于使用的,但仍需要进行一些编程设置,例如连接应用程序界面和编写应用程序逻辑的代码。这些设置需要开发者具有基本的编程知识才能完成。

最后,一些高级功能,如应用程序的网络连接和存储管理,需要编程知识才能实现。缺乏这些知识将导致应用程序的性能下降或出现严重问题。

总之,虽然苹果公司提供了易于使用的开发工具,但仍需要开发者具备基本的编程知识。只有这样,他们才能创建稳定、高效和有用的应用程序。

相关文章
  • App上架

    App上架是指将开发好的移动应用程序提交到应用商店进行审核,审核通过后才能在应用商店上架销售。本文将介绍App上架的原理和详细流程。一、App上架原理App上架的原理是将应用程序提交到应用商店,应用商店对应用进行审核,审核通过后将应用发布在应用商店上架销售。在提交应用程序之前,开发者需要先注册一个开...

    2023-10-13
  • 安卓app封装浏览器

    安卓应用封装浏览器: 原理与详细介绍随着移动互联网的快速发展,各种应用程序层出不穷,满足了大家的各种需求。其中,安卓平台作为一个全球最受欢迎的移动操作系统,有着丰富的应用生态。安卓应用封装浏览器就是其中一种被广泛运用的开发模式。本文将为你详细介绍安卓应用封装浏览器的原理及其相关内容。1. 安卓应用封...

    2023-11-25
  • 云打包app打包网址

    云打包是一种将应用程序打包成可供安装的安装包的服务。这种服务可以在网上提供,也可以在本地使用。云打包的主要目的是方便开发人员将应用程序打包成安装包,使其更容易地分发和安装。云打包的原理是将应用程序和所有相关文件打包成一个安装包,然后上传到云端。云端服务将对安装包进行处理,生成一个可供下载和安装的安装...

    2023-10-12
  • eclipse安装教程安卓开发

    Eclipse是一种流行的集成开发环境(IDE),是Java开发人员中最喜欢的IDE之一。它不仅支持Java编程语言,还支持其他编程语言,如C++,PHP,Python等。Eclipse是开放源代码的软件,由Eclipse基金会开发和维护。本文将介绍如何在Eclipse中进行安卓开发。1. 下载安装...

    2023-11-04
  • 安卓11开发者有哪些功能

    Android 11 是谷歌迄今最新推出的安卓操作系统,针对移动设备提供更加智能的体验和更强的安全保障。下面,我将介绍 Android 11 中的一些新的开发者功能。 1. 融合屏幕和折叠屏幕支持Android 11 将继续支持融合屏幕和折叠屏幕设备,为开发者带来更多的机会,创造新的用户界面和体验。...

    2023-11-15